Extended Observations

Frosted Mini-Wheats has earned its place as a pantry staple — the four-box bundle makes that commitment easy to justify, and the original formula still holds up.

Some products have been around long enough that reviewing them feels almost beside the point. Frosted Mini-Wheats Original is one of those. The cereal has been on American breakfast tables since 1969, and the formula — whole grain wheat biscuits, one frosted side, one plain — has barely changed. That consistency is itself a kind of quality signal.

The four-box bundle sold here is the practical version of the purchase. Each box runs about 18 oz, putting you in the neighborhood of 72 oz total. For households with kids, or for anyone who eats cereal more than twice a week, that volume makes sense. The per-ounce price is better than single-box retail, and the Subscribe & Save option on Amazon trims it further.

On the nutritional side, the whole grain wheat base delivers 6g of fiber per serving — meaningful for a cereal that also has enough sweetness to keep kids engaged. The frosting is restrained by modern standards; it does its job without tipping into candy territory. The biscuits hold their structure in milk for a reasonable amount of time before softening, which matters if you eat slowly or get distracted.

The fit here is straightforward: families who go through cereal quickly, or anyone stocking a pantry for the week ahead. The four-box format removes the friction of restocking, and the original flavor is the one most likely to satisfy the widest range of eaters at the table.

Two notes worth making: the packaging is cardboard and inner bag — nothing special, and the bags occasionally arrive slightly unsealed in transit when ordered online. Also, the sugar content (12g per serving) is worth acknowledging for households watching added sugar closely. Neither issue is a dealbreaker, but they're worth knowing going in.
